Sister Ernestine (Elizabeth) Mersek was born Feb. 13, 1914, at Rockvale, Colo., to John and Margaret (Blatnick) Mersek. She professed her vows as a Sister of Mary of the Presentation on Feb. 9, 1935, in Broons, France. She attended Logan Elementary School in Spring Valley, IL, and high school at St. Catherine High School in Valley City. After her novitiate in France, she went to Paris for one year to help care for the sick at the Holy Cross Father’s Minor Seminary.
After her return to the United States, she worked at St. Margaret’s Hospital in Spring Valley and later went to St. Andrew’s School of Nursing in Bottineau, graduating in 1949.
After Sister Ernestine received her RN degree, she went to Minneapolis, Minn., to receive her degree as a nurse anesthetist. She worked in that capacity for 30 years.
Sister Ernestine’s third career was in the Pastoral Care Department in Spring Valley. In July 1999, she retired too Maryvale Convent near Valley City.

Sister Albert Marie (Helen Mitzel) was born Aug. 6, 1913, in Orrin, N.D., to Philip and Elizabeth (Volk) Mitzel. At a young age she was placed under the guardianship of Anton and Justina (Stroder) Burkhartsmeier. She attended elementary school in Rugby, and later attended boarding schools in Willow City and Valley City. She received her standard diploma in elementary education from the Catholic University in Washington, DC.
Sister Albert Marie professed her vows as a Sister of Mary of the Presentation on Feb. 8, 1934, in Broons, France. After her vows, she spent one year in Guernsey (Channel Islands) doing a variety of work and returned to the United States in 1935. She then began her teaching career in the primary grades and taught in the Catholic Schools in Willow City, Wild Rice, Oaks, Walhalla, and Valley City, all in North Dakota. She retired from teaching in 1985 and served many years as sacristan and tending plants at Maryvale.
